FORT LAUDERDALE, Fla. — A dog fight and a shooting left two dogs dead, two dogs injured, and a dog owner injured on Friday in Fort Lauderdale, according to police.
A group of dogs got into a fight at about 9:30 a.m. in the area of Northwest 11th Avenue and Seventh Street in the Homes Beautiful Park area.
One of the dog owners was armed with a gun and shot four dogs, including two that died at the scene of the fight, according to police.
A second dog owner suffered a dog bite while trying to break up the fight, and Fort Lauderdale Fire Rescue personnel responded to treat him, according to police.
Police officers with FLPD’s Animal Crimes Unit responded to investigate the incident.
